Event Overview
​The curriculum is targeted at early-stage leaders: recently appointed or aspiring managers or supervisors. The program focuses on the practical knowledge and skills needed to succeed in management and leadership in higher education. Topics to be covered in the course include: interpersonal communication skills; budget and finance; managing time and priorities; project management; leadership modes; and performance management.

Participants should expect to participate regularly online during each week of the program. You must be able to commit up to five hours per week every week from February 11 - March 31. Each week of the course will include videos, discussions and activities. Participants and faculty will meet face-to-face on April 3-4, 2018 and will participate in additional activities and networking opportunities. Attendance in both the online and face-to-face components of the program are required.
